OBJECTIVE: To assess the accuracy of preoperative ultrasound-guided multilevel fine-needle aspiration (FNA) cytology and thyroglobulin (Tg) estimation in mapping metastatic levels in the lateral neck, in patients with papillary thyroid carcinoma (PTC).Entities:

Number of harvested and pathologic lymph nodes of the lateral neck among all patients
| Neck level | Harvested lymph node (mean ± SD) | Pathologic lymph node (mean ± SD) |
|---|---|---|
| IIA | 6.4 ± 3.7 | 0.6 ± 0.9 |
| IIB | 4.0 ± 2.3 | 0.1 ± 0.3 |
| III | 8.5 ± 4.5 | 2.3 ± 1.9 |
| IV | 9.8 ± 5.7 | 2.1 ± 2.0 |
| VB | 3.8 ± 3.2 | 0.1 ± 0.4 |
| Total | 31.8 ± 10.7 | 5.2 ± 3.5 |
Abbreviation: SD, standard deviation.

Diagnostic value of preoperative FNA‐C or FNA‐C with Tg for 293 lateral cervical levels in comparison with histopathology. The sensitivity, specificity, and accuracy of FNA‐C vs FNA‐C plus Tg were compared using McNemar's test
| Histopathology(n) | FNA‐C | FNA‐C + Tg |
| ||
|---|---|---|---|---|---|
| + | − | + | − | ||
| + (222) | 154 | 68 | 190 | 32 | |
| − (71) | 0 | 71 | 7 | 64 | |
| Sensitivity | 69.4% | 85.6% | <.001 | ||
| Specificity | 100% | 90.1% | .016 | ||
| Accuracy | 76.8% | 86.7% | <.001 | ||
Abbreviations: FNA‐C, fine‐needle aspiration cytology; Tg, thyroglobulin.
